North Korea conducts nuclear test

Photo by yeowatzup
North Korea has tested another nuclear weapon, its second underground nuclear test, according to its state news agency.
The state released a celebration video commemorating the successful test.

Obama to Netanyahu: talks with Iran won’t last forever

Photo by timtom.ch
The leaders of Israel and the U.S. met in the Oval Office Monday to talk about the threat of Iran and the Israeli-Palestinian question.
